A job’s working conditions

Painters and decorators often work 40 hours a week or more to complete their projects (eight hours a day, five days a week). As in many other fields, construction workers must work longer hours when demand is very strong. The quantity of extra work you’ll be expected to put in will depend on the industry in which you work and the region where you work. In addition, the terms of each contract will be different. Temperature and humidity might affect how long you can paint outdoors. During the warmer months, you may opt to work more hours, while during the colder months, you may choose to work fewer hours.

Education and acclaim in one’s profession go hand in hand

  • Apprenticeship

In the construction industry, apprenticeship programmes are often employed as a launching pad for future workers. This kind of training is done both in the classroom and on the job, and is overseen by a trained painter London and decorator who is known as a journeyman.

  • Taking Part in an Apprenticeship Training Program

Apprenticeship programmes in painting and decorating might have different entry requirements depending on the province you live in. The majority of provinces and territories need you to have completed secondary III, which is grade 9 in most cases.

  • The duration of the show in total

To become a painter and decorator in Canada, you’ll need to complete an apprenticeship programme that varies from province to province. There are three 12-month periods, each of which involves at least 3,900 hours of work experience, three eight-week blocks of technical teaching, and a final test leading to certification for each of the three.

Certification

If you’re looking for a job as a painter London and decorator, you’ll need to be certified in Quebec. However, throughout the rest of Canada, certification is just encouraged but not required. Even if acquiring the certificate is optional, it is highly recommended that you do so. Examining your certification can let potential employers and co-workers know that you are an accredited professional. It may also help you get a new career.
